We spent the last weeks of August in Greece, in the Ionian Islands.

We took a ferry boat from Igoumenitsa, a coastal city in the northwestern part of mainland Greece, to Kerkyra.

There is a bakery at the port in Igoumenitsa where I had the most amazing spinach pie.

We took the ninety minute ferry ride to Corfu under the bright moon light.

Kerkyra is an island in the Ionian Islands. Because the Venetians sieged and occupied Kerkyra from the medieval times and into the seventeenth century, the city’s architecture is distinctly Italian and not Greek.

Using Kerkyra as our base, we took ferry boats to other islands in the Ionian Sea. I will try to supplement this post with pictures of the other islands when I am able.
